We believe that success with ADHD is possible... with a little translation. Hosts Asher Collins and Dusty Chipura, both ADHD coaches who have plenty of insight to share navigating their own ADHD experiences, discuss how to live more authentically as an adult with ADHD and how to create real, sustained change to achieve greater success. If you are an adult with ADHD who wants more out of their business, career, and life, this is the podcast for you!

Navigating Kink: An ADHD Perspective on Pleasure and Safety

In this episode, Ash and Dusty explore the intriguing intersection of kink and ADHD, discussing how neurodivergent individuals may be drawn to unconventional sexual interests. They emphasize the importance of curiosity and communication in navigating the complexities of kink, particularly for those who may struggle with societal norms or personal inhibitions. Through personal anecdotes and insights, they highlight the potential for self-discovery and growth within the kink community, advocating for a safe and open-minded approach to exploring one's sexuality.
The conversation also delves into the significance of establishing trust and safety in power dynamics, particularly for individuals with ADHD who may face unique challenges in relationships. Ash and Dusty discuss red flags to watch out for in potential partners, emphasizing the critical role of consent and ongoing communication. Ultimately, they encourage listeners to embrace curiosity in their sexual journeys, fostering an environment where both partners can express their desires freely and explore new experiences together.
